The challenge
Exposure Analytics are pioneers in event tracking technology, offering tools like footfall tracking, heat mapping, and dwell-time measurement. While their tech was cutting-edge, their previous website didn’t reflect this. The site focused heavily on devices and data capture – but didn’t clearly communicate the value or results of their services.
The team wanted to modernise their website, update the messaging to focus more on outcomes than hardware, and showcase their innovative approach with a clearer brand presence.

Refining the message
I worked closely with Rob & Dan to understand what Exposure Analytics really offers: data that drives decisions. Together, we shifted the site’s focus from hardware features to business outcomes – helping their clients understand not just what the technology is, but what it does for them.
We developed a clearer content hierarchy, introduced a more conversational brand voice, and restructured the layout to guide users toward key pages and calls to action. This was presented in Figma as a prototype (see image)
Modernising the design
While we kept the original logo and primary brand colour, I introduced a more dynamic colour palette to help key areas of the site stand out. This visual refresh carried through to their print work too, helping create a more unified brand identity across platforms.

Bringing the data to life
One of the most engaging features of the new site is the live statistics. Using data from their dashboard, the site displays real-time figures – showing how many visitors they’ve tracked, total events, and dwell-time metrics. It was a fantastic way to demonstrate the scale and power of their platform at a glance.
Making the complex feel simple
Explaining sensor-based tracking tech to non-technical users is no easy task. To help visualise their offering, I collaborated with Charlotte to create a custom illustration showing how the sensors work within an event space. I added subtle animations to give it an extra layer of clarity and polish.

The result
Since launch on 13th February 2025 (writing this in April 2025), the site has had a tangible impact on Exposure Analytics’ marketing performance:
- +84% active users
- +84% new users
- +118% organic search traffic
- +48% direct traffic
- 9 new leads (up from 7)
- 1 converted client + 3 highly engaged leads (compared to no new customers in the previous period)
